10 Tips for Beginner Singers to Improve Their Vocal Range

Jul 11, 2023

Are you a beginner singer looking to improve your vocal range? Developing a wider vocal range is essential for any aspiring singer, as it allows you to explore different genres and hit those high notes with ease. While it may seem challenging at first, with practice and the right techniques, you can expand your vocal range and unlock your full singing potential. In this post, we will share 10 tips to help beginner singers improve their vocal range.

1. Warm up your voice

Before you start any singing practice, it's crucial to warm up your voice. Just like any other muscle, your vocal cords need to be warmed up to perform at their best. Start with gentle humming or lip rolls to gently stretch and warm up your vocal cords.

2. Practice proper breathing techniques

Good breath control is essential for expanding your vocal range. Take deep breaths from your diaphragm instead of shallow breaths from your chest. This will help you support your voice and hit those high notes effortlessly.

3. Work on your posture

Your posture plays a significant role in your vocal range. Stand up straight or sit tall with your shoulders relaxed. This allows your lungs to expand fully and gives your voice more room to resonate.

4. Start with vocal exercises

Vocal exercises are a great way to improve your vocal range. Start with simple scales and gradually increase the difficulty. Focus on hitting both the low and high notes, gradually pushing your limits.

5. Experiment with different vowel sounds

Each vowel sound requires different muscle coordination. Experiment with different vowel sounds while practicing scales and exercises. This will help you discover which sounds are easier for you to sing and which ones need more work.

6. Practice regularly

Consistency is key when it comes to improving your vocal range. Set aside regular practice sessions and stick to them. Even short practice sessions every day will yield better results than sporadic long sessions.

7. Seek professional guidance

Consider taking voice lessons from a qualified vocal coach. A professional instructor can provide personalized guidance and help you develop proper techniques to expand your vocal range effectively.

8. Take care of your voice

Your voice is your instrument, so it's essential to take care of it. Stay hydrated, avoid excessive yelling or screaming, and limit your intake of foods and beverages that can irritate your vocal cords, such as caffeine and alcohol.

9. Record and analyze your progress

Recording yourself while practicing can help you identify areas that need improvement. Listen back to your recordings and analyze your progress over time. Celebrate your achievements and use them as motivation to keep pushing forward.

10. Have patience and enjoy the process

Expanding your vocal range takes time and patience. Remember to enjoy the process and celebrate small victories along the way. With dedication and perseverance, you will see significant improvements in your vocal range.
